About This Item
Charters Publishing Co, nd. ca. 1935. Hardcover. ex library-good/Good. g, 205 p. 19 cm. B&w illustrations, mainly portraits. Blue cloth hardcover with yellow print. Gold dustjacket. Ex library with labels on spine and endpapers, ink stamps on endpapers, p. d and bottom edge. Jacket taped to book. Pages browning.
Includes the Home and School Creed and A Parents Code of Ethics. Index.
